Queen’s South Africa 1899-1902, 4 clasps, Cape Colony, Orange Free State, Transvaal, S.A. 1902 (Capt. H. D. Harvest, Leins. Rgt.) clasps crudely riveted, otherwise good very fine £130-160

This lot was sold as part of a special collection, The Michael McGoona Collection to the Leinster Regiment.

Major Hector Douglass Harvest was born on 17 April 1867; commissioned into the Dorset Regiment, with the rank of 2nd Lieutenant on 11 February 1888; transferred to the Leinster Regiment on 17 October 1888; Lieutenant, 1 April 1890; Captain, 1 February 1895; employed with the Army Pay Department, 9 November 1897 to 31 May 1900.
